Pat Kirwin said on Sirius this afternoon that he had just finished watching the game film. The Pats used a 3-man rush for most of the game. The trick was that it was never clear which 3 would rush as they routinely brought inside linebackers up to the line pre snap showing blitz. Then, at the snap, the two DTs would rush along with ONE of the two DE/OLBs or ONE of the two ILBs. Everyone else would drop into coverage.

I don't think the idea was to confuse the blocking schemes and sack Manning, not rushing 3. The idea was to use the blitz looks to disguise the coverages (see Ninko interception).

Stupidly asked, what are the drawbacks of using a 2-4-5 ?

Light against the run. Especially with Niko and Ayers as the outside guys and Collins as an inside LB, the Pats were very heavy pass defense last night. A light, fast defense to try to deal with all the receivers.
